基于HTML5的旅游网.zip
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
【HTML5技术详解】 HTML5,全称HyperText Markup Language第五版,是Web内容的标记语言,是HTML的最新标准,旨在提升网络应用的性能、兼容性和互动性。这一技术的出现极大地推动了互联网的发展,使得网页制作更加简洁且功能更加强大。 一、HTML5的新特性 1. **语义化元素**:HTML5引入了更多的语义化元素,如<header>、<footer>、<nav>、<article>和<section>等,这些元素能够更好地描述页面结构,提高了网页内容的可读性和可访问性。 2. **离线存储**:HTML5的离线存储机制(Application Cache)允许开发者将网站的部分数据存储在本地,使用户在离线状态下也能访问部分网页内容。 3. **多媒体支持**:HTML5新增了<video>和<audio>元素,使得网页可以直接嵌入视频和音频,无需依赖Flash等外部插件。同时,支持多种编码格式,如MP4、WebM和Ogg。 4. **Canvas绘图**:HTML5的<canvas>元素提供了一个可编程的画布,通过JavaScript可以实现动态图形绘制,广泛应用于游戏、图表、动画等领域。 5. **SVG矢量图**:支持内联SVG图像,可以创建高质量、可缩放的图形,对分辨率不敏感,适合于移动设备。 6. **Web Workers和Web Storage**:Web Workers允许在后台线程执行复杂计算,提高网页性能;Web Storage则提供了比Cookie更大的存储空间,改善了本地数据的管理。 7. **Geolocation定位**:通过API获取用户的地理位置信息,为地图服务和基于位置的应用提供了可能。 8. **Web Socket**:提供了双向通信的能力,使得实时应用如聊天室、在线游戏等得以实现。 二、HTML5在旅游网站中的应用 1. **响应式设计**:HTML5的媒体查询功能可以帮助开发者创建响应式网站,适应不同设备的屏幕尺寸,提升用户体验,尤其在移动设备上浏览旅游网站时。 2. **地图集成**:利用HTML5的Geolocation API,旅游网站可以提供基于位置的服务,如附近的景点推荐、导航指引等。 3. **多媒体展示**:旅游网站可以利用HTML5的<video>和<audio>元素播放目的地介绍视频、旅行日记音频,增强用户的感知和兴趣。 4. **交互式旅游规划**:通过Canvas或SVG,用户可以自定义行程规划,创建个性化地图,添加标注和路线。 5. **离线阅读**:对于大型的旅游指南或者攻略,HTML5的离线存储可以让用户在没有网络的情况下也能查看和参考。 6. **游戏化体验**:结合WebGL,可以开发旅游主题的小游戏,增加用户参与度和娱乐性。 7. **表单增强**:HTML5的新的表单输入类型和验证功能,如date、email等,使得预订过程更加便捷和安全。 总结起来,HTML5以其强大的功能和广泛的应用,正在改变着旅游网站的设计和用户体验。随着技术的不断进步,我们可以期待更多创新的交互方式和丰富的旅游服务出现在基于HTML5的网站中。
- 1
- 2
- 3
- 4
- 5
- 粉丝: 2256
- 资源: 5989
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助